HR departments might use automated hiring technologies to make the best hiring decisions. For a business, automation is essential: “When it comes to enterprise firms and where digital transformation begins, the hiring process is where it all begins. Enterprise recruiting teams are more streamlined and efficient in hiring the best personnel due to digitally transforming HR. It’s critical to have the correct applicant tracking system (ATS) in place to help you engage with prospects and employees both before and after they’re hired. The average time to hire a company using a historical applicant tracking system is over 42 days. In contrast, the time to recruit for a company using a more modern applicant tracking system can be cut in half simply because of the built-in automation and integrations these newer products have.

Remote workforce and management visibility in real-time

Recently, many service-oriented organizations have developed regulations regarding remote working. However, putting together an efficient remote workforce is more difficult than it seems. A remote project manager has numerous obstacles, ranging from delayed decision-making to managing global resource pools and lacking responsibility to productivity issues. Project and resource managers can establish a productive remote workforce while preserving and securing firm data with the correct project time tracking, analytics, governance, and practice-centrics digital technologies.
